FUEL SYSTEM (PGM-FI)
6-49
REMOVAL
• It is impossible to disassemble the fuel pump
after removing it.
Relieve the fuel pressure and disconnect the quick
connect fitting (page 6-44).
Clean around the fuel pump.
Disconnect the fuel pump 5P connector.
Remove the fuel pump mounting nuts.
Remove the set plate and fuel pump unit from the
fuel tank.
Remove the packing from the fuel pump unit.
INSPECTION
Check for fuel pump unit for wear or damage.
Check for fuel suction filter for wear or damage.
Replace the fuel pump unit if necessary.
